Output 0889e64d531e0817e85913962054be13bf4f02a2a7e9efe9bda7936ba3b8d21d:0

value
104923757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3931e8803108eff073252dbd51b8a0fe661412f OP_EQUAL
address
MRjGErzQVDZJTXhcYjkWudM6aSccUMFQKS
transaction
0889e64d531e0817e85913962054be13bf4f02a2a7e9efe9bda7936ba3b8d21d
spent
true